package com.dell.doradus.olap.collections;
import java.nio.ByteBuffer;
import java.nio.CharBuffer;
import java.nio.charset.CharsetDecoder;
import java.nio.charset.CharsetEncoder;
import com.dell.doradus.common.Utils;
public final class UTF8 {
private final CharsetEncoder utf8_encoder = Utils.UTF8_CHARSET.newEncoder();
private final CharsetDecoder utf8_decoder = Utils.UTF8_CHARSET.newDecoder();
public static void toLower(char[] src, int srcOffset, int srcLength) {
int end = srcOffset + srcLength;
for(int i = srcOffset; i < end; i++) {
char c = src[i];
if(c < 0x80) {
if(c >= 'A' && c <= 'Z') c += 32;
src[i] = c;
}
else src[i] = Character.toLowerCase(c);
}
}
public int encode(char[] src, int srcOffset, int srcLength, byte[] dst, int dstOffset) {
for(int i = 0; i < srcLength; i++) {
if(src[srcOffset + i] > 0x80) {
int len = encodeInternal(src, srcOffset + i, srcLength - i, dst, dstOffset + i);
return i + len;
} else {
dst[dstOffset + i] = (byte)src[srcOffset + i];
}
}
return srcLength;
}
public int decode(byte[] src, int srcOffset, int srcLength, char[] dst, int dstOffset) {
for(int i = 0; i < srcLength; i++) {
if(src[srcOffset + i] < 0) {
int len = decodeInternal(src, srcOffset + i, srcLength - i, dst, dstOffset + i);
return i + len;
} else {
dst[dstOffset + i] = (char)src[srcOffset + i];
}
}
return srcLength;
}
private int encodeInternal(char[] src, int srcOffset, int srcLength, byte[] dst, int dstOffset) {
CharBuffer cb = CharBuffer.wrap(src, srcOffset, srcLength);
ByteBuffer bb = ByteBuffer.wrap(dst, dstOffset, dst.length - dstOffset);
utf8_encoder.reset();
utf8_encoder.encode(cb, bb, true);
utf8_encoder.flush(bb);
int length = bb.position() - dstOffset;
return length;
}
private int decodeInternal(byte[] src, int srcOffset, int srcLength, char[] dst, int dstOffset) {
ByteBuffer bb = ByteBuffer.wrap(src, srcOffset, srcLength);
CharBuffer cb = CharBuffer.wrap(dst, dstOffset, dst.length - dstOffset);
utf8_decoder.reset();
utf8_decoder.decode(bb, cb, true);
utf8_decoder.flush(cb);
int length = cb.position() - dstOffset;
return length;
}
}
